Marvel and Netflix cancel 'The Punisher' panel
NETFLIX 12820 carmichael show Hannibal jerrod carmichael marvel and netflix cancel marvel and netflix cancel nycc Marvel's The Punisher Mr Robot netflix the punisher New York Comic Con nycc news shoot-up-able Shooter shooter tv the punisher comic-con the punisher gun violence the punisher new york city the punisher news the punisher panel the punisher pulled from nycc